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of chicken broth production technology, specifically to a cooking device for chicken broth. Background Technology
[0002] Chicken broth is a traditional Chinese tonic soup, mainly made by slowly extracting the essence of chicken through a double-boiling method, with little or no water added, resulting in a concentrated chicken broth. It is characterized by its delicious flavor and rich nutrition, and is often used for postpartum recovery, conditioning of weak constitutions, or daily nourishment. The production of chicken broth involves processes such as cutting, washing, draining, and steaming. A pressure cooker is used for steaming the chicken.
[0003] When steaming chicken in a pressure cooker, the sieved chicken pieces are placed in a steaming frame and then transferred to the pressure cooker for steaming. During the steaming process, the essence from the chicken meat and bones will drip out. This essence is the main component of chicken peptides. The steaming time is 6-8 hours to ensure that the essence is fully extracted. When putting the chicken in and taking it out, a hoisting device is used to put the wire mesh box containing the tray into the pressure cooker or take it out from inside it.
[0004] However, in existing technologies, when hoisting net cages, operators typically connect the hooks to the net cages manually. When the net cages are removed from the pressure cooker, operators are not only prone to burns from the pressure cooker, but also, due to the lack of limiting at the connection point between the hooks and the net cages, the movement of the hooks during hoisting can easily cause the net cages to sway. This swaying can cause the dripping chicken broth in the tray to spill out, resulting in waste of the dripping chicken broth. Therefore, we propose a device for cooking dripping chicken broth. Utility Model Content
[0005] In view of the above-mentioned shortcomings of the existing technology, the present invention provides a device for cooking chicken broth stock solution, which can effectively solve the problems mentioned in the background technology.
[0006]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ution:
[0007] This utility model provides a device for cooking chicken broth concentrate, comprising:
[0008] The frame has a top cover and two symmetrically distributed high-pressure cooking pots inside the frame.
[0009] The lifting mechanism includes a drive motor fixedly connected to the outside of the top cover. The drive motor is fixedly connected to a threaded rod via an output shaft. An internal threaded plate is threadedly connected to the outside of the threaded rod. A winch is installed on the outside of the internal threaded plate. A rope is provided on the outside of the winch's reel. A round block is fixedly connected to the other end of the rope. A round tube is provided on the outside of the round block.
[0010] The picking and placing mechanism includes a fixed plate fixedly connected to the bottom of the circular block. A servo motor is installed at the bottom of the fixed plate. The servo motor is fixedly connected to the circular block through an output shaft. An inner recessed plate is provided below the circular block. Three movable holes are opened on the outer side of the inner recessed plate and are evenly distributed. Movable rods are slidably connected to the inner side of the movable holes.
[0011] Preferably, two symmetrically distributed limiting rods are fixedly connected to the inner side of the top cover, and two symmetrically distributed limiting holes are opened on the outer side of the internal thread plate, with the limiting rods slidably connected to the inner side of the limiting holes.
[0012] Preferably, the outer side of the circular block is adapted to the inner side of the circular tube, and two symmetrically distributed brackets are fixedly connected to the outer side of the circular tube, the brackets being fixedly connected to the outer side of the internal thread plate.
[0013] Preferably, three equally spaced rotating shafts are fixedly connected to the side of the disk away from the servo motor, and the movable rod is movably connected to the outside of the rotating shafts through bearings.
[0014] Preferably, all three movable rods are fixedly connected to a stop block on their outer sides.
[0015] Preferably, three connecting rods with equal spacing are fixedly connected to the outside of the fixed disk, and all three connecting rods are fixedly connected to the outside of the concave disk.
[0016] Preferably, a lifting platform is provided on the inner side of the frame, and a wire mesh box for placing into the pressure cooker is provided above the lifting platform. Three hanging ears distributed at equal intervals are fixedly connected to the outer side of the wire mesh box, and a tray for placing materials is provided on the inner side of the wire mesh box.
[0017] The technical solution provided by this utility model has the following advantages compared with the known prior art:
[0018] 1. This utility model, through the setting of the lifting mechanism, when the material is taken out of the high-pressure cooking pot, as the rope contracts, when the net box is moved out of the high-pressure cooking pot, the round block enters the round tube. Under the limitation of the round block and the round tube, the net box is not easy to shake under the action of the rope when it moves, which effectively prevents the spillage of the dripping chicken broth inside the tray and avoids the waste of dripping chicken broth during hoisting.
[0019] 2. By setting up a pick-and-place mechanism, this utility model eliminates the need for operators to manually connect the hoisting equipment to the net cage when placing or removing it from the high-pressure cooker. This not only improves the efficiency of net cage removal but also prevents operators from being scalded by the net cage or the high-pressure cooker, thus enhancing the safety of the device. [0054] The workflow of this utility model is as follows:
[0055] When it is necessary to remove the wire mesh 410 after steaming, open the lid of the high-pressure steam cooker 3, drive the threaded rod 504 to rotate through the output shaft, move the inner concave plate 401 to the top of the pot body with the lid open, and the winch 503 releases the line until the inner concave plate 401 is lowered to the appropriate height under the action of the rope and then stops.
[0056] Servo motor 406 drives disk 404 to rotate via output shaft. The rotation of disk 404, under the action of rotating shaft 408, pushes movable rod 405 in movable hole 409 to extend into the insertion hole on hanging ear 411 until the stop block 403 contacts the outside of hanging ear 411.
[0057] The winch 503 rotates in the reverse direction to wind up the rope. When the net box 410 is completely removed from the pot, the round block 508 enters the round tube 507. Under the action of the round block 508 and the round tube 507, the net box 410 below is limited. The drive motor 502 drives the threaded rod 504 to rotate in the reverse direction, moving the net box 410 above the lifting platform 413. The winch 503 performs the line release operation until the net box 410 falls on the lifting platform 413.
[0058] The servo motor 406 is driven to rotate in the opposite direction. Under the action of the rotating shaft 408, the movable rod 405 is retracted, disconnecting from the wire mesh box 410. The lifting platform 413 lowers the wire mesh box 410 to a suitable height. At this time, the tray 412 inside the wire mesh box 410 can be taken out to complete the cooking of the dripping chicken broth.
